Get ready for the grand spectacle as the Ogwashi-Uku Carnival, Delta State’s premier cultural celebration, marks its 13th anniversary on December 25, 2023.

Founder and Chief Host, Anthonia Oguah, announced the much-anticipated event in a press release on Thursday, highlighting the significance of this annual festivity that showcases the vibrant cultural heritage of the Ogwashi-Uku people.

Known as a time for merriment, bonding, and reuniting with loved ones both locally and internationally, this year’s Carnival promises a delightful array of activities. From a lively road walk to a dazzling Fashion Parade, captivating Cultural Dance Troupes, and an array of local delicacies, there’s something for everyone.

Generously sponsored by the Ogwashi-Uku Association USA Incorporated, Oguah assures attendees that the 2023 Carnival will be a standout experience. Anticipate a special celebration filled with variety, featuring the participation of Ogwashi-Uku sons and daughters from around the globe.

Oguah emphasized the exceptional efforts invested by her team in organizing this year’s event, promising an even more remarkable experience than previous carnivals. Having meticulously studied past celebrations, the team has crafted an excellent plan to ensure a memorable and entertaining occasion.

Prepare for a grand, distinctive, and thoroughly enjoyable experience at the Ogwashi-Uku Carnival 2023 – a celebration like no other!
